随着移动设备的普及,混合移动应用成为了开发者们的首选。Ionic 是一个基于 HTML、CSS 和 JavaScript 的混合移动应用框架,它具有强大的功能和良好的性能,使开发者能够轻松创建高质量的移动应用。
为什么选择Ionic
Ionic 提供了许多强大的特性,使它成为开发者的首选:
1. 跨平台开发
Ionic 使用 HTML、CSS 和 JavaScript 来构建应用程序界面,相比于原生应用开发语言,如 Java 或 Swift,跨平台开发更加简单快捷。你只需要编写一次代码,就可以在多个平台上运行,包括 iOS、Android 和 Web。
2. 开发速度快
Ionic 提供了开发工具和预设组件,使开发速度大大提升。你可以使用预设的样式库和UI组件来构建应用程序界面,从而减少开发时间。
3. 强大的 UI 组件
Ionic 提供了丰富多样的 UI 组件,如按钮、导航栏、列表、卡片等,你可以根据应用的需求轻松地定制和使用它们。
4. 支持原生功能
Ionic 提供了许多插件,使你能够访问设备的原生功能,如相机、地理位置、推送通知等。这些插件使你的应用程序能够与设备无缝地交互。
5. 丰富的生态系统
Ionic 拥有庞大的社区和插件生态系统,你可以从社区中获取帮助,并使用插件扩展应用程序的功能。
如何开始使用Ionic
安装 Ionic CLI
首先,你需要安装 Ionic CLI。打开命令行工具,运行以下命令安装 Ionic CLI:
npm install -g @ionic/cli
创建 Ionic 应用
使用以下命令创建一个新的 Ionic 应用:
ionic start myApp blank
这将创建一个名为 myApp 的空白 Ionic 应用。
运行应用
进入应用目录:
cd myApp
然后运行以下命令来在浏览器中预览应用程序:
ionic serve
你将在浏览器中看到应用的默认界面。
构建应用
当你准备将应用程序部署到移动设备时,你需要构建应用程序。你可以使用以下命令进行构建:
ionic build
这将在项目的 www 目录下生成构建文件。
添加页面和功能
要添加新的页面和功能,你可以使用 Ionic 提供的命令行工具。以下是一些常用的命令:
ionic generate page pageName:创建一个新的页面。ionic generate service serviceName:创建一个新的服务。ionic cordova plugin add pluginName:添加 Cordova 插件。
你可以在 Ionic 的官方文档中找到更多有关命令行工具的信息。
结论
Ionic 是一个强大且易于使用的混合移动应用框架,它使开发者能够轻松构建高质量的移动应用程序。通过使用 Ionic,您可以节省开发时间,并在多个平台上运行您的应用程序。如果你正在寻找一个跨平台移动应用解决方案,那么 Ionic 绝对值得一试。

评论 (0)